A Verdant Dream
 Yesterday night I saw a pellucid dream  Of a place I have never dreamt of  Vales, woods, savannahs and stream  All welcomed me with a gaiety laugh   Chirping birds, water dashes and light showers  Poured honey into my ears  Verdant woods and all-hued flowers  Filled my eyes with joyful tears   Bees, butterflies and birds beckoned me  To ingest the nature’s bounty  Trees were bathed in the vernal showers with exhilarating glee  Bulbuls were on their hasty flight to an another county   In that mystic dream I couldn't separate myself from the nature  I felt like I had roots that connect all  Just then I realized nature’s stature  It embraces everything to become a connected whole
